Why did you make this work:
I was commissioned by Met MUnch at Manchester Metropolitan University to create engaging illustrations to go alongside a Food Safety & Hygiene Training course. Information was provided by Met MUnch Nutritional Sciences students & illustrated by myself with additional design by Molly O'Donoghue. The aim of the project was to turn the course information into a playful and easily digestable format.

How was the illustration used:
The Illustrations were used across a Food Safety and Hygiene Training Presentation for use of MMU students and participants at the Ripples of Hope Festival.

How did you make this work:
My materials of choice are often a combination of gouache & pastels layered onto paper cutouts. I enjoy letting buildings, characters & objects form shape from this handcrafted act of drawing with scissors. The process allows me the freedom to explore my ideas & compositions in a tactile & playful manner. I then add finer details digitally where needed using Adobe Fresco’s live brushes.

Biography:
Maisy is a freelance Illustrator & Animator, Lecturer at Manchester School of Art, & Creative Director of Small Fry Collective hosting creative events across Manchester & beyond. Maisy works closely with clients on projects that often have storytelling & community at their centre. Clients Include; Google Arts & Culture, British Council, Sunday Times, Elephant Academy & Paperchase.
